# Client setup for Squatwatch, our internal typo-squatting package
# scanner. This instantiates the registry-diff client that compares
# incoming package names against the protected namespace list.
# Reviewer note: the timeout is intentionally 30s because the
# Levenshtein pass on large namespaces is slow. Authentication
# uses the service key defined immediately below:

service key, fawip-bajef: kto11_Qt5wZK9vdNC

### Step 3: Ship the Idempotency Middleware

Heads up for this week's deploy: the Quillpay retry handler now requires an idempotency key on every POST to the charge endpoint. Keys are minted client-side from the order fingerprint, so replays collapse into one charge. Roll the middleware out behind the `retry_safe` flag, watch the duplicate-charge alarm, then ramp to 100%. Tag and sign the build with the key that follows:

release key, kahif-yagap: bky3_1JN

Meeting notes — Driftwell auth sync, excerpt

We dug into the session-token refresh bug again. Turns out refresh requests fired twice when the tab regained focus, and the second one invalidated the first token. Fix: debounce plus a server-side grace window. For future maintainers: don't remove the grace window, it's load-bearing. Long-term ownership of this area now belongs to the engineer below.

named custodian: Brivan Eliath Quenox Frador

Finance Review — Lumero Plus Tier

For heads of department. Q2 uptake: 2,900 subscribers, 12% above forecast. Margin per seat holds at 61% despite onboarding costs. Churn negligible. Marketing spend efficient; no reallocation needed. Upsell from the base Lumero plan drives 70% of conversions. Board guidance on next steps follows below.

board note of bawep-tajef: Queniusek Systems plans to raise the Quenvan list price by 53.1 percent in March. The pricing group signed off on a budget of $176.4 million for Project Drueth. The renewal with Casionix Partners closes at $142.5 million a year, 8.3 percent below the last contract. Project Fraax slips by six weeks because of the tooling delay.